CHARLOTTE, N.C. — Jimmy Butler scored a season-high 32 points, Bam Adebayo had 21 points and 11 rebounds and the Miami Heat and remained unbeaten in NBA In-Season Tournament play with a 111-105 win over the shorthanded Charlotte Hornets on Tuesday night. Duncan Robinson added 18 points for the Heat, who've won six straight games. Miami is 2-0 in group play; the Hornets are 1-1. P.J. Washington had 32 points and six of Charlotte's season-high 15 3-pointers. LaMelo Ball added 28 points, 11 assists and six rebounds. The Heat finished off a 4-0 road trip that included wins against San Antonio, Atlanta and Memphis.
